Re: txAMQP and newer RabbitMQ versions (>= 2.4)
- Is anybody using txAMQP successfully with a newer versions of
RabbitMQ (2.4 or later). If so what version of txAMQP are you using
and did you have do to anything special to get it to work?
I'm using txAMQP with RabbitMQ 2.7.1, and it seems to work fine. I'm
using the latest version from bazaar, which seems pretty stable to me.
I'm also using the 0.9.1 AMQP spec.
